    The National Institute for Implementation Research in Non Communicable Diseases, Jodhpur came into existence on 07th December 2019. The institute is located in Jodhpur and it replaces the erstwhile Desert Medicine Research Centre.     The foundation stone of AIIMS Delhi was laid in 1952. [2] The first AIIMS was established in 1956 under the All India Institute of Medical Sciences Act, 1956. [3] Originally proposed to be established in Calcutta, it was established in New Delhi following the refusal of Chief Minister of West Bengal Bidhan Chandra Roy. [4]

    Richa Singh. Richa Singh is an Indian computer scientist whose research concerns biometrics, including face recognition and iris recognition. She is a professor and head of the Department of Computer Science & Engineering at IIT Jodhpur. [1]
